ggplot绘制柱状图 python_ggplot2堆积柱形图笔记

这篇博客介绍了如何使用ggplot2在Python中创建分组柱形图和堆积柱形图,详细讲解了如何自定义填充颜色、添加标签以及处理堆积柱形图的细节。内容包括调整标签位置、改变数据格式以实现特定效果,并提供了示例代码和结果展示。
摘要由CSDN通过智能技术生成

#creat a dataset(生成数据)

specie

condition

value

df

library(ggplot2)

#分组柱形图

p1

p1+theme(legend.position = "none")#去掉右侧图例

p1+scale_fill_manual(values=c("blue","red","green"))#自定义填充色

Rplot09.png

Rplot10.png

Rplot11.png

#堆积柱形图

ggplot(df,aes(x=specie,y=value,fill=condition))+geom_bar(stat="identity")

ggplot(df,aes(x=specie,y=value,fill=condition))+

geom_bar(stat="identity")+

geom_text(aes(label=value),position=position_stack(vjust=0.5))#添加标签

可以比较一下一下三条命令出图的区别

ggplot(df,aes(x=specie,y=value,fill=condition))+

geom_

  • 0
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值